What is the compound interest on rupees 2500 for 2 years at 12% per annum?

  1. Given: P = 2,500, t = 2 years and r = 12%
  2. Concept used: A = P (1 + r/100)t Here, A = amount, P = principal, r = rate of interest, t = time,
  3. Calculation: A = 2500 × (1 + 12/100)2 A = 2500 × (28/25) × (28/25) A = 3136. Now, ...
  4. ∴ The correct answer is 636. Shortcut Trick. 12% = 3/25. 625 unit = 2500. 1 unit = 2500/625 = 4.

What is the compound interest on 2000 at 3% pa for 2 years?

Detailed Solution
  1. Given: Principal amount = Rs. 2000. Rate of interest = 3% pa. ...
  2. Concept used: Compound interest, CI = P(1 + R/100)n - P. where. P = Principal amount. ...
  3. Calculation: So, the compound interest.
  4. ⇒ 2000 (1 + 3/100)2 - 2000.
  5. ⇒ 121.80. ∴ The compound interest on Rs 2,000 for 2 years at 3% p.a. is Rs. 121.80.
